    I did this over an hour ago and it hasn't credited. It says it's still being verified. I seem to have a lot of trouble with the offers.

    Are you on a MAC ? I know Toria has troubles which could be put down to using a MAC

    What browser are you using ? Is it up to date ?
    Same with Java ?
    Same with Flash Player ?

    For anyone reading with no technical knowledge I am simply trying to point out that some offers and surveys have been coded so they work best in a certain browser and/or may need updated flash player or anything such like in order to run fully and track fully as well. Therefore it could be wise to check everything is up to date on the computer first.

    If you still feel concerned, possibly send an email to the offer wall company and/or swagbucks asking them to check your account for you to make sure you haven't been blocked in anyway for whatever reason

    I do offers, some credit, some don't .. those that don't tend to be the spammy "win this prize" type ones and those that require clicking lots of "no"'s on pages etc
    I tend to avoid them now

    LOL. I gave up sending in screenshots as I only ever got the reply that my answers hadn't been received. If they don't credit it's always been a case of "Tough, there's nothing we can do!"

    Screenshots are a law unto themselves

    You have to have time and date showing in botttom right hand corner
    You need to have your email address partially showing as well, the one that you use for swagbucks
    And also the swagbucks website open, as well as the survey complete page
